Two iconic cities, two iconic teams, two iconic captains, two iconic fan-bases, one iconic battle.

Let’s admit it, this was probably the first game you’d marked out when the schedule was out. At RCB’s home, in front of a packed audience, this is going to be as loud as the WPL has ever been. It might be an away game, but it’s a ground where Mumbai Indians have very fond memories, having found multiple ways to silence the sea of Red over the last sixteen years in the IPL. It’s time to bring that to the WPL.

Both teams have gotten off to very similar starts so far in the season, winning their respective first game by the skin of their teeth, winning the second one comfortably, and then losing their third. They’re coming in hungry and keen to stay in the top three. More importantly, the bragging rights that could potentially last a lifetime are at stake.
